Okay wow, this was not good. I swear I cannot trust you arc readers. I love a surprise pregnancy book and I saw this recommended by a bookstagram girly and the reviews were so good I had to try it. Y’all lied to me.
This book was about as basic as basic can be. There was no character development, the smut overshadowed the plot, and the plot that was there was uninteresting.
To start, the author gives us a fully developed MMC. He’s the perfect boyfriend from the jump. He’s sweet, loyal, and willing to do anything for his girl. He’s a very likable character but he’s perfect from the start so there’s no room for this character to grow.
The FMC is a bit selfish and seems to take without giving anything in return. She doesn’t let our MMC tell his friends or family about her or the baby so they spend the first half of the book in a secluded bubble. She puts all her needs above his. Then towards the end she has a teeny tiny bit of character development when she shows up at a very important football game for him. I was baffled by how this character is only at this point realizing that she needs to support him. Really?! Then when she’s like okay, I’ll meet your friends it’s too late. This character was just annoying. Also, she makes a big deal about being a doctor and not losing her priorities for him and honestly that’s fine but guess what…. Is there a mention of her becoming a doctor in the epilogue or anywhere else? Nope. This major plot point is just forgotten by the end.
I thought the side characters were under utilized and under developed.
Lastly, sooooooo many chapters start with, “The last few weeks have been busy”. I was like wow, didn’t I just read that? I think the author needed to mix it up a bit.

Emma is our FMC…working hard in college towards becoming a doctor and fully invested in her golfing…she’s focused on her goals and will let nothing get in her way. Emma is sweet but guarded. Loss early on in life and a family history of health issues has carved the path for who she wants to be but has also made her extremely cautious.
Archie is our golden retriever MMC. Tall, built like a dream, the man is a literal walking green flag….hes a star football player on his college team and well on his way to the NFL after graduation. But he’s also a playboy…he loves the ladies and the ladies love him.
One night out at the college bar changes things for both Emma and Charlie. They meet and there is instant chemistry. One night of passion is all it takes for Archie to fall….for him to realise that he wants more than just one night. Emma feels it’s too but she’s not willing to give him more than a night. She’s too focused on her future and needs no distractions. Especially someone like Archie.
For weeks Archie searches for Emma…realising that he wants her and needs to tell her how he feels. Emma is definitely avoiding him…but, after a few weeks and two pink lines later. Emma realises she needs to find Archie and tell him what is happening.
The way Archie handles this news is beyond perfection. He’s so supportive and so happy. He is having a baby with the girl of his dreams. Watching their relationship develop was beautiful. The way he cared and supported Emma through all her fears and apprehension with the pregnancy was so amazing. He never let her feel like she was alone. Reminding her that they are a team.
My one thing that kept this from being a 5 star read was Emma. I loved her. Love love loved her. BUT…I wish she was more supportive of Archie. This man was all in for her…wanted to shout it from the rooftops. But it felt like she wanted to keep him secret. Not wanting him to tell his friends about her. Never going to his games except for one. I know she loved him and had her issues that she was trying to work through…trying to process how life was changing. But I just wanted to see her put as much effort into him as he was putting into her.

Archie was absolutely amazing from start to finish. He was immediately on board and supportive about the pregnancy and did everything to make sure Emma was okay. There was never a moment he questioned becoming a dad young or what it would mean to his future career in the NFL. Right from the start it was him and Emma doing what they needed to fulfill their education and career goals, while putting their relationship and baby first. The two things that I didn’t like were how only one of his friends knew she was pregnant and it was because he overheard in the beginning and one of Emma’s friends knew because she was with Emma when she found out. Other than that no one knew. Emma didn’t want anyone knowing and I thought it was a little selfish. Not to mention unbelievable because even by 26 weeks no one knew. And the other thing was that throughout the entire story it was all about Emma becoming a doctor and how it was her main priority, but then there’s no mention of it the last couple chapters or a year later in the epilogue.
